Hanover Park (Cook County) home prices rise in February 2017

Re 14

The median sale price of a home sold in February 2017 in Hanover Park in Cook County rose by $27,000 while total sales decreased by 5.9%, according to BlockShopper.com.

In February 2017, there were 16 homes sold, with a median sale price of $175,000 - a 18.2% increase over the $148,000 median sale price for the same period of the previous year. There were 17 homes sold in Hanover Park in February 2016.

The median sales tax in Hanover Park for 2017 was $4,932. In 2016, the median sales tax was $5,008. This marks an decrease of 1.5%. The effective property tax rate, using the median property tax and median home sale price as the basis, is 2.8%.
